In recent years, Bitcoin has emerged as a popular cryptocurrency that has gained significant attention from investors and enthusiasts alike. As the demand for Bitcoin continues to rise, so does the need for mining, which is the process of validating transactions and adding them to the blockchain. However, traditional Bitcoin mining methods can be expensive and require substantial computing power. This is where cloud computing comes into play, offering a game-changing approach to Bitcoin mining.
Cloud computing refers to the delivery of computing services over the internet, allowing users to access resources such as servers, storage, and applications without the need for physical infrastructure. By leveraging cloud computing for Bitcoin mining, individuals and organizations can tap into the vast computing power of remote data centers, reducing the costs and complexities associated with traditional mining methods.
One of the primary advantages of using cloud computing for Bitcoin mining is the cost-effectiveness. Traditional Bitcoin mining requires expensive hardware, such as ASIC (Application-Specific Integrated Circuit) miners, which can cost thousands of dollars. Additionally, running these miners requires a significant amount of electricity, further increasing the operational costs. In contrast, cloud mining eliminates the need for expensive hardware and infrastructure, as users can rent computing power from cloud service providers at a fraction of the cost.
Another significant benefit of using cloud computing for Bitcoin mining is the scalability. Cloud service providers offer flexible and scalable computing resources, allowing users to adjust their mining power based on their needs. This means that users can start with a small amount of computing power and gradually increase it as their investment grows. This scalability makes cloud mining an attractive option for both beginners and experienced miners looking to expand their operations.
Moreover, cloud computing provides users with enhanced security and reliability. Cloud service providers have robust security measures in place to protect their infrastructure and data from cyber threats. This ensures that users' mining activities are secure and their investments are protected. Additionally, cloud mining services often offer high uptime guarantees, minimizing the risk of downtime and ensuring continuous mining operations.
However, there are some considerations to keep in mind when using cloud computing for Bitcoin mining. One of the main concerns is the trustworthiness of cloud service providers. It is crucial to research and choose reputable providers with a proven track record in the industry. Additionally, users should carefully review the terms and conditions of the cloud mining contracts, ensuring that they understand the fees, withdrawal policies, and any potential risks involved.
In conclusion, using cloud computing for Bitcoin mining offers a game-changing approach that addresses the challenges associated with traditional mining methods. The cost-effectiveness, scalability, and enhanced security provided by cloud computing make it an attractive option for individuals and organizations looking to participate in the Bitcoin mining ecosystem. However, it is essential to conduct thorough research and choose reliable cloud service providers to ensure a successful and profitable mining experience. As the demand for Bitcoin continues to grow, cloud computing is poised to play a crucial role in shaping the future of Bitcoin mining.
